I have a 2018 diesel CRV. As I accelerated onto an island, the car seemed to seize up for a brief second and a warning light appeared, it only displayed for a short period but since then the car doesn’t seem to run the same. The warning light was front profile of car with solid line beneath and an up wood pointing arrow beneath that. Local Honda garage haven’t a clue what it could be

I have a '66 plate. I've had it appear once when I approached the vehicle in front too quickly. "City brake active system". Changes to this symbol when the vehicle is stopped by the system.

The symbol before is a car with an exclamation mark. Page 502 in my gen 4 manual. It should reset when you set off again. Like stop/start does.

There are a few examples when it can be triggered when there's no car in front. E.g. speed bumps, parking, walls etc. Only had it that once though. I think 'too quickly' triggered it.
